    Comments Thread For: Angel on Khan Rematch: No Chin, Can't Break an Egg

    Amir Khan (27-3, 19KOs) will have no chance at winning a rematch with WBA/WBC junior welterweight champion Danny Garcia (25-0, 16KOs), according to the boxer's father/trainer Angel Garcia.

    Angel sat ringside in Los Angeles and watched Khan, now being trained by Virgil Hunter, beat up previously undefeated Carlos Molina, who moved up from the lightweight division.

                I didn't realize it until I saw Khan's record, but damn, Khan hasn't really had a decent KO or KD in a while. Salitas was probably the only one in a 4 year period. Barrera was stopped on cuts, which has more to do with Khan's hand speed than power. Malignaggi was one of those being outclassed type of stoppages, but he wasn't dropped. He got Maidana with a good body shot, but anyone can go down if hit in the right spot and isn't necessarily indicative of power. McCloskey was a crap cut stoppage. Judah was a weird body shot/low blow/quittage KO. The Peterson KD was bull**** and should have been ruled a slip. And he couldn't drop a blown up lightweight in Molina.
